Abstract

The utility model provides the equipment with cleaning and garbage disposal function, is related to cleaning and field of garbage disposal.Equipment with cleaning and garbage disposal function, including conveying device, dustbin cleaning device, collection bucket cleaning device and refuse disposal installation;The dirty dustbin that automatic collecting cart is withdrawn is delivered in dustbin cleaning device by conveying device to be cleaned, and the dustbin after cleaning is transported to next station by conveying device;The rubbish that automatic collecting cart is withdrawn is placed in collection bucket, and the collection bucket equipped with rubbish is delivered at refuse disposal installation by conveying device, and the rubbish in collection bucket is poured onto refuse disposal installation;Collection bucket after dumping rubbish is moved to collection bucket cleaning device under the drive of conveying device and is cleaned, and the collection bucket after cleaning again passes by conveying device and is transported to next station.Alleviate the problem of inconvenient garbage disposal in the prior art and dustbin, collection bucket cleaning inconvenience.

A kind of equipment with cleaning and garbage disposal function provided in this embodiment, including conveying device 100, dustbin Cleaning device 200, collection bucket cleaning device 300 and refuse disposal installation 400;Wherein, the dirty rubbish that automatic collecting cart 500 is withdrawn Rubbish bucket is delivered in dustbin cleaning device 200 by conveying device 100 and is cleaned, and the clean dustbin after cleaning is again Next station is transported to by conveying device 100;The rubbish that automatic collecting cart 500 is withdrawn is placed in collection bucket 510, and is equipped with The collection bucket 510 of rubbish is delivered to the feeding end of refuse disposal installation 400 by conveying device 100, and will be in collection bucket 510 Rubbish is poured onto refuse disposal installation 400, realizes the processing to rubbish;And the collection bucket 510 after dumping rubbish is filled in conveying It sets to be moved under 100 drive at 300 station of collection bucket cleaning device and be cleaned, and the collection bucket 510 after cleaning passes through again It crosses conveying device 100 and is transported to next station.
A kind of specific work process of equipment with cleaning and garbage disposal function provided in this embodiment are as follows:
The equipment is mainly used for handling rubbish, dirty dustbin and dirty collection bucket 510 that automatic collecting cart 500 is got back, Specific: the collection bucket 510 that automatic collecting cart 500 carries the dirty dustbin being superimposed and fills rubbish is moved to conveying At the front end inlet of device 100, conveyed by conveying device 100 fill rubbish collection bucket 510 it is mobile, when being moved at rubbish When managing 400 top of device, collection bucket 510 is reversed 180 °, so that the rubbish in collection bucket 510 is poured over downwards garbage disposal dress 400 feeding end is set, realizes the processing to rubbish;Collection bucket 510 after dumping rubbish continues to move backward, and collects when being moved to When the top of bucket cleaning device 300, high pressure water is sprayed to collection bucket 510 by collection bucket cleaning device 300, to realize to collection The cleaning of bucket 510, the collection bucket 510 after cleaning is then transported to next station again by conveying device 100, in order to continue to make With.
The dirty dustbin that automatic collecting cart 500 is withdrawn then is transported in dustbin cleaning device 200, is cleaned in dustbin Under the action of high pressure water in device 200, dustbin is cleaned, and the dustbin after cleaning then again passes by conveying device 100 are transported to next station, in order to continue to use.
In the present embodiment, the cleaning to dirty dustbin can be realized by dustbin cleaning device 200;It is clear by collection bucket Cleaning device 300 can be realized the cleaning to dirty collection bucket 510;It can be realized by refuse disposal installation 400 to withdrawal rubbish It collects, processing;It can be realized the transfer to dustbin, collection bucket 510 by conveying device 100;The equipment can either be real as a result, Existing cleaning function, and have the function of garbage disposal, while using the equipment, reduce artificial cleaning bring trouble, reduces Cost of labor improves cleaning efficiency and garbage treatment efficiency, is further conducive to better people's living environment.
In the optional technical solution of the present embodiment, conveying device 100 includes the first conveying mechanism 110, second conveyor structure 120 and third conveying mechanism 130;First conveying mechanism 110, second conveyor structure 120 and third conveying mechanism 130 are from front to back Successively interval setting;The first turnover mechanism 140 is provided between first conveying mechanism 110 and second conveyor structure 120, second is defeated It send and is provided with the second turnover mechanism 150 between mechanism 120 and third conveying mechanism 130.
In the optional technical solution of the present embodiment, the first conveying mechanism 110, second conveyor structure 120 and third conveyer Structure 130 includes conveyer belt 111, is provided with the first clamping structure on conveyer belt 111;The second clamping is provided on collection bucket 510 Structure;First clamping structure is used cooperatively with the second clamping structure, enables collection bucket 510 with the first conveying mechanism 110, Two conveying mechanisms 120 and third conveying mechanism 130 are mobile.
In the optional technical solution of the present embodiment, the first turnover mechanism 140 and the second turnover mechanism 150 include clamping group Part 141 and overturning component;Clamping component 141 can clamp collection bucket 510, and overturning component can drive collection bucket 510 It is overturn.
Specifically, the first conveying mechanism 110 is used to the collection bucket 510 for filling rubbish being transported to the first turnover mechanism 140 Locate, then the rubbish in collection bucket 510 is poured into the feeding end of refuse disposal installation 400 by the first turnover mechanism 140;And topple over Collection bucket 510 after rubbish is moved to second conveyor structure 120 by the first turnover mechanism 140, and collection bucket 510 is in the second conveying When moving in mechanism 120, the collection bucket cleaning device 300 of lower section sprays high pressure water to collection bucket 510, to realize to collection bucket 510 cleaning;The collection bucket 510 cleaned is transferred to the second turnover mechanism 150 by second conveyor structure 120, and passes through the Two turnover mechanisms 150 overturn 180 °;Collection bucket 510 by overturning is transferred to third conveying mechanism by the second turnover mechanism 150 On 130, and next station is transported to by third conveying mechanism 130, in order to subsequent processing.By each in conveying device 100 A mechanism, complete rubbish in collection bucket 510 topple over and the automatic cleaning of collection bucket 510, improve garbage treatment efficiency And cleaning efficiency.
Further, the first conveying mechanism 110, second conveyor structure 120 and third conveying mechanism 130 include conveyer belt 111, more transmission shafts are arranged in driving wheel 112 and actuator on body, and driving wheel 112 is then arranged on transmission shaft, conveyer belt 111 are set on driving wheel 112, and actuator uses motor, connect with driving wheel 112 or transmission shaft driven, passes through actuator Driving wheel 112, conveyer belt 111 can be driven to move, so as to realize the transport of collection bucket 510.
It should be noted that due under original state collection bucket 510 be located on automatic collecting cart 500, to make collection bucket 510 are moved on the first conveying mechanism 110, need to apply external force to collection bucket 510, as a result, in the present embodiment, in conveyer belt 111 It is upper to be provided with the first clamping structure, and the second clamping structure is provided on collection bucket 510, so, when automatic collecting cart 500 When close to the arrival end of body, the first clamping structure can be matched with the second clamping structure, defeated on the first conveying mechanism 110 Under the drive for sending band 111, collection bucket 510 is pulled on the first conveying mechanism 110, and as the first conveying mechanism 110 is mobile.This Preferred in embodiment, the first clamping structure uses grab, and the second clamping structure is using card slot or card hole etc., that is, the first clamping Structure can be clamped or thread off with the second clamping structure, in order to realize the conveying to collection bucket 510;Furthermore it is also possible to adopt With the fit system of plectrum and allocating slot, that is, allocating slot is arranged in the two sides of collection bucket 510, multiple groups are arranged on conveyer belt 111 and dial Piece, in 111 moving process of conveyer belt, plectrum can stir allocating slot, to realize that collection bucket 510 can be with conveyer belt 111 is mobile.Herein it should also be noted that the specific structure about the first clamping structure and the second clamping structure is unrestricted, only It can be realized above-mentioned function, be not specifically described, it is, of course, also possible to reference to the prior art.Similarly, second conveyor structure 120, third conveying mechanism 130 equally realizes the transport to collection bucket 510 using above-mentioned principle, is not repeated herein.
Further, it is contemplated that overturning and transfer to collection bucket 510,140 He of the first turnover mechanism in the present embodiment Second turnover mechanism 150 includes clamping component 141 and overturning component;Specifically, clamping component 141 includes turnover bracket 1413, nip rolls 1411 and conveyer belt 1412, multiple groups nip rolls 1411 is in two layers of arrangement, and conveyer belt 1412 is respectively sleeved at two layers of folder On roller 1411, and there are certain gap between two groups of conveyer belts 1412, nip rolls 1411 is then connect with power source;When the first conveying When collection bucket 510 is transferred at the first turnover mechanism 140 by mechanism 110, the edge of 510 two sides of collection bucket then enters two groups of biographies It send between band 1412, under the drive of conveyer belt 1412, collection bucket 510 works as collection with the mobile a distance of conveyer belt 1412 When the both sides of the edge of bucket 510 are entirely located between two groups of conveyer belts 1412, the overturning actuator driving overturning branch in component is overturn Frame 1413 rotates 180 °, and synchronous drive collection bucket 510 overturns 180 °, realizes the overturning of collection bucket 510.Similarly, the second overturning The working principle of mechanism 150 is similar to the working principle of the first turnover mechanism 140, is not set forth in detail herein.
In the optional technical solution of the present embodiment, collection bucket cleaning device 300 is set to 120 lower section of second conveyor structure, And the collection bucket 510 transferred on second conveyor structure 120 can be cleaned.
In the present embodiment, the rubbish in collection bucket 510 is toppled over first, then collection bucket 510 is cleaned, specifically , it dumps rubbish at the first turnover mechanism 140, is cleaned at second conveyor structure 120, at this point, collection bucket 510 It is opening down and opposite with second conveyor structure 120, it is sprayed as a result, by the collection bucket cleaning device 300 of lower section to collection bucket 510 High pressure water is penetrated, to realize the cleaning to collection bucket 510.
In the optional technical solution of the present embodiment, refuse disposal installation 400 includes disintegrating mechanism 410,420 and of transfer mechanism Sorting mechanism 430;Disintegrating mechanism 410 is set to the lower section of the first turnover mechanism 140, and the first turnover mechanism 140 can will be collected Rubbish in bucket 510 is poured in disintegrating mechanism 410;It is transferred through the smashed rubbish of disintegrating mechanism 410 by transfer mechanism 420 It is sorted to sorting mechanism 430.
In the optional technical solution of the present embodiment, sorting mechanism 430 includes that detection unit, sorter assemblies 431 and multiple groups are slipped Slot 432;The control device of detection unit and equipment connection, for detecting different types of rubbish;Sorter assemblies 431 include multiple groups Mechanical grip, mechanical grip are connect with control device;Under the control action of control device, mechanical grip is according to detection unit Different types of rubbish is respectively clamped in corresponding chute 432 by testing result, and is sent by chute 432 to corresponding collection In case 433.
Refuse disposal installation 400 in the present embodiment includes disintegrating mechanism 410, transfer mechanism 420 and sorting mechanism 430, Wherein, disintegrating mechanism 410 includes funnel and crushes roller, and the rubbish under toppling in collection bucket 510 is accepted via funnel, and is leaked To crushing on roller, rubbish is crushed by crushing roller rotation;Smashed rubbish is delivered to via transfer mechanism 420 Sorting mechanism 430 carries out different types of sorting, and transfer mechanism 420 uses conveyor belt herein;Sorting mechanism 430 specifically includes Detection unit, sorter assemblies 431 and chute 432, the rubbish of unit detection passes through the mechanical folder in sorter assemblies 431 after testing Claw clip is got in different chutes 432, and is slipped and sent to different collecting boxs 433 by chute 432.Herein it should be noted that closing The prior art can be referred in detection unit, the working principle of sorter assemblies 431, such as sorting machine is not set forth in detail herein.
In the optional technical solution of the present embodiment, dustbin cleaning device 200 includes rack 210, third turnover mechanism 220, the first elevating mechanism 230, the 4th conveying mechanism 240, wiper mechanism 250, the second elevating mechanism 260 and the 4th turnover mechanism 270;Third turnover mechanism 220 and the 4th turnover mechanism 270 are respectively arranged at arrival end and the outlet end of rack 210, use respectively In the dustbin that overturning is superimposed;4th conveying mechanism 240 is located at 210 top of rack, and wiper mechanism 250 is located at rack 210 lower parts, for the 4th conveying mechanism 240 for clamping and transferring dustbin, wiper mechanism 250 can be to the 4th conveying mechanism 240 The dustbin of transfer is cleaned;First elevating mechanism 230 and the second elevating mechanism 260 are located at the 4th conveying mechanism 240 Both ends at, be respectively used to promote or decline the dustbin that is superimposed.
In the optional technical solution of the present embodiment, the 4th conveying mechanism 240 includes driving assembly 241, annular mounting bracket 242 and multiple groups clamp hand 243;Annular mounting bracket 242 is sequentially connected with driving assembly 241, and driving assembly 241 can drive annular Mounting bracket 242 is moved relative to rack 210;The interval of multiple groups clamp hand 243 is lifted in annular mounting bracket 242.
In the optional technical solution of the present embodiment, conveying device 100 further includes the first clamping device and the second clamping device; First clamping device is disposed in proximity at the position of 200 arrival end of dustbin cleaning device, the dirty rubbish for will be superimposed Rubbish bucket is transferred on third turnover mechanism 220;Second clamping device is disposed in proximity to the position of 200 outlet end of dustbin cleaning device Place is set, for the clean dustbin being superimposed to be transferred to conveying device 100 from the 4th turnover mechanism 270.
The specific work process of the dustbin cleaning device 200 are as follows:
It is superimposed, and is sent to third turnover mechanism 220 via the dirty dustbin that automatic collecting cart 500 is collected back, The axis of dirty dustbin is in a horizontal state at this time, after third turnover mechanism 220 starts, the axis of dirty dustbin is overturn 90 °, is made The dirty dustbin being superimposed is opening down, and is located at the top of the first elevating mechanism 230;The starting of first elevating mechanism 230 Afterwards, dirty dustbin is jacked up, is in dirty dustbin within the scope of the clamping of the 4th conveying mechanism 240;When the 4th conveying mechanism 240 When clamping the dirty dustbin of top, the first elevating mechanism 230 declines certain altitude, at this point, the dirty dustbin of top is by the The horizontal transfer of four conveying mechanism 240, and so on, each dirty dustbin is clamped by the 4th conveying mechanism 240, and horizontal transfer, During transfer, the wiper mechanism 250 positioned at 240 lower section of the 4th conveying mechanism sprays into high pressure water into dirty dustbin, realizes Cleaning process, the clean dustbin after cleaning is sequentially transplanted on 260 top of the second elevating mechanism, at this point, the second elevating mechanism 260 Rising and accept clean dustbin, then declines, next cleaning dustbin then again moves into 260 top of the second elevating mechanism, Second elevating mechanism 260 rises the clean dustbin of undertaking again, and so on, realize the superposition to clean dustbin;It is superimposed upon It is axis horizontal that clean dustbin together, which is overturn by the 4th turnover mechanism 270 from axis vertical, and is transplanted on third conveyer On structure 130, next station is finally transported to by third conveying mechanism 130.
Specifically, the 4th conveying mechanism 240 includes driving assembly 241, annular mounting bracket 242 and multiple groups clamp hand 243, it is more Group clamp hand 243 is lifted in annular mounting bracket 242, and clamp hand 243 includes clamping jaw cylinder and clamping jaw;When driving assembly 241 drives When annular 242 loopy moving of mounting bracket, multiple groups clamp hand 243 is then as annular mounting bracket 242 is mobile, so as to realize pair The clamping of each dustbin.
Third turnover mechanism 220 and the 4th turnover mechanism 270 include flip piece 221 and overturning actuator, flip piece 221 It is rotatably arranged in rack 210, overturning actuator can drive flip piece 221 to rotate relative to rack 210, and realization is turned over Turn.Specifically, flip piece 221 uses L-shaped structure, overturning actuator is preferably servo motor.Flip piece 221 includes bottom plate and slot Plate, frid is arc-shaped, forms L-shaped structure by bottom plate and frid, and through-hole is opened up on bottom plate, that is, when on flip piece 221 The dustbin axis vertical being superimposed when, the first elevating mechanism 230, the second elevating mechanism 260 output end can be from It is passed through in through-hole, to realize the jacking to dustbin.Preferably, the first elevating mechanism 230, the second elevating mechanism 260 are all made of Cylinder.
